Hassan Akl Commits to Aurora University

Lloydminster, AB – The Lloydminster Bobcats are thrilled to announce Hassan Akl has committed to play NCAA Division III hockey with Aurora University.

“Hassan was a very impactful offensive acquisition at the trade deadline this year and he made an immediate impact on our offensive group,” stated Bobcats Head Coach and General Manager Nigel Dube. Akl would have an instant impact on the special team’s side as the Bobcats powerplay moved to sixth in the league to finish the regular season, “he was able to create and make plays offensively which set up some really nice goals in the second half. His hockey IQ is elite, and the Aurora fans are going to enjoy watching him!” finished Dube.

In 20 games following the January 10th trade deadline with the Bobcats Akl posted 3 goals and 19 assists. In 134 games in the Alberta Junior Hockey League, he posted 30 goals and 72 assists for 102 total points!

The Lloydminster Bobcats would like to congratulate the Akl family on his commitment to the Aurora University. Akl becomes the fifth commitment this season for the Bobcats joining Ethan Aucoin (St. Cloud State), Tegan Skehar (University of Alaska Fairbanks), Kolby Thornton (Aurora University) and Zafir Rawji (MRU – Usport). Akl becomes the Lloydminster Bobcats 11th commitment in the last two seasons.
